The exclusivity clause/s might have insignificant effects on the competition if their scope is limited to the same building or to a limited area within the relevant geographic related market. If the market position of the tenant and the landlord on their relevant markets triggers is weaker, the exclusivity clause in the lease agreement may have less negative impact. An exclusivity clause, when adequately drafted, restricts the landlord from leasing out space within the same complex or building to competing tenants with the same type of business.
